Regarding the profanity rule (foul language, cursing, cussing, and etc.):

There has been an uproar lately over the censorship of foul language. This decision was handed down by the site administrators, who are OUR bosses. So, in an attempt to clarify, this post will explain the nuances of the rule.

1. The rule itself applies only to forums that are not in the Taunting Arena (Zones 1 and 2). Though words may still be filtered in the Taunting Arena, actions that would normally be enforceable, like attempting to circumvent the filter, will not be enforced, that includes gifs and pictures. (see 4).

2. The rule does not apply to private messages and other non board comments.

3. Words that may seem like cussing, such as daggumit, dadgumit, freaking, frikkin', or 'son of a biscuit' are not seen as attempts to circumvent the filter.

4. Using special characters to evade the filter in Zones 1 and 2 as stated in the forum guidelines, are enforceable actions. If the word appears as ***** (rhymes with witch) and you intentionally use an exclamation mark for example, like so: b!tch, that is seen as evasion of the filter.

5. Not all posts that violate this rule can be monitored. Please report it. Abuse of the report function will get your privilege to report posts revoked.


6. This rule is still under development and is subject to change until finalized by forum leadership.

FAQ:

Q: Is it OK to cuss if the words get filtered out?

A: To my knowledge, yes, so long as you don't evade the filter.

Q: Is it a more serious bannable offense to avoid cussing by typing similar but not offensive words (like "fricking?").

A: No.

Q: Is it a rule violation to say a cuss word if the filter does not recognize it as one and lets it through?


A: No. But be aware that this could be subject to change.

H/T toobfreak
 
FAQ (Cont'd):

Q: What parts of the forum does this rule apply to?

A: Zones 1 ( forums marked as Clean Debate) and 2 (Politics and etc.)

Q: What parts of the forum are exempt?

A: Zone 3 (The Flame Zone, Badlands, and Rubber Room).
